ParticipantRe: Candy fridge freezer
Do you mean the tray on top of the compressor (black motor unit round the back)? If so, the replacement tray is p/no 97590921. spares@ukwhitegoods.co.uk will be able to get one for you. It’ll be a special order part, so a little patience will be required.
No, it should never get full of water. A little condensate will run into it and be evaporated off.

February 26, 2009 at 8:42 pm in reply to: BOSCH WFT2800GB/13 DRYER PROBLEM- It lives to fight on #276525Penguin45
ParticipantRe: BOSCH WFT2800GB/13 DRYER PROBLEM- Any Bosch techs out th
Inlet valve – inside of the machine where the fill hose joins on. One of the coils is a feed to the condesnser. Nominal reading of 3.5kOhms when split from the circuit.
Condenser housing. The moulding under the blower motor. Prone to filling up with fluff and strangling the airflow. Poor airflow – overheats – safety trips.
NTC sensor. Should give a reading in kOhms when metered. This reading should fall as the device is warmed.
Power off first, please.
